98a05b61b3 Add metadata block to replays
The replay files are just streams all network communication so to
get any info out of them it is necessary to play back the stream
until the wanted information is reached.

This introduces a new metadata block placed at the end of the
replay files and logic to read the new block, or fall back to
playing back the stream for older files.

The replay browser is also updated to use the metadata information
instead of reading the replay stream directly.
